Weaver is the Australian Star of the Year

Animal Kingdom actress Jacki Weaver has been named Australian Star by the Year at the Australian International Movie Convention. Madman sales manager Lee Hunter received the trophy on Weaver’s behalf.

Avatar received the top honours for highest grossing film in both Australia and New Zealand, while Mao’s Last Dancer and Boy received awards for highest grossing local films respectively.
